However, the user can enter other values for the denominator … WebAir density, like air pressure, decreases with increasing altitude. It also changes with variation in temperature or humidity. At sea level and at 15 °C, air has a density of approximately 1.225 kg/m 3 (0.001225 g/cm 3 , 0.0023769 slug/ft 3 , 0.0765 lbm/ft 3 ) according to ISA (International Standard Atmosphere).
